The Global Women’s Forum Dubai (GWFD) 2024 is announced to take place for the third time on 26-27 November at Madinat Jumeirah; it globally leading organizations & key opinion leaders in a mission to empower women and discuss Gender Parity issues globally.
This year’s theme, “The Power of Influence,” encompasses key focus areas: As such, the conference themes include Future Economies, Future societies, Collective Engagements and Collective Actions and Impactful Technologies and Impactful Innovations. It delivers opportunities for life-changing workshops, panel discussions, and keynote speeches to design and develop solutions for social justice.

Her Excellency Mona Al Marri, Chairperson of Dubai Women Establishment said that ‘GWFD 2024 is not simply a forum but a cause that is striving to open doors to fair chances and achieve women’s full potential’.
GWFD 2024 stresses partnership compatibility to implement changes to balance gender concerns economically, socially, and politically. The Forum aims at being a platform for promoting global changes by show casing leaders, innovators, and activists to foster more changes within the global community to retain a sustainable and mutant economy.
